What Is Airtable?

A powerful database platform — built for teams that already know what they're doing.

Airtable is a cloud-based database platform that blends the look of a spreadsheet with the power of a relational database. It was built for teams who need flexible data management — think project tracking, content calendars, product roadmaps, and CRM pipelines.

  • Genuinely flexible
    Create linked tables, build custom views, set up automations, and connect to hundreds of other tools via integrations.
  • Strong following among tech teams
    Startups, marketing teams, and operations managers at mid-to-large companies love it for structured data management.
  • Steep curve for non-technical users
    If you have no database background, Airtable can feel like assembling furniture without instructions — the pieces are all there, but figuring out how they fit takes real time and effort.

1. Ease of Setup: Minutes vs. Days

With Airtable, getting started is deceptively easy — you can create a table in minutes. But building something that actually works for your business is a different story. You need to manually define every field type, set up table relationships, configure views, write formulas, and figure out how to share it with your team. For someone without a database background, this process can take days.

With Ambisius, you describe what you need in plain language — and the AI builds the entire app automatically. Tables, relationships, calculated fields, validations, dashboard, and analytics — all ready without touching a single setting.

2. Business Logic: Does the Tool Think Like Your Business?

Airtable is a database tool — it stores and organizes data well. But it doesn't come with built-in business logic. Things like preventing a sale when stock is zero, automatically calculating an appointment's end time, or blocking a double-booking require Airtable's Automations and formula fields — which take technical knowledge and ongoing maintenance to build.

Ambisius is built with business logic at its core. These aren't add-ons you configure — they're built into how the platform works.

3. Team Collaboration: Control vs. Complexity

Both tools allow you to share access with your team — but the experience is very different. In Airtable, you share at the "base" level with broad roles. It's hard to say "this person can only add sales records, but can't see the analytics or edit product prices."

In Ambisius, access control works per menu and per action — giving you precise control over exactly what each team member can see and do.

4. Pricing: Seats vs. Usage

Airtable's pricing is per-seat — the cost grows as your team grows. Once you need advanced automations, increased record limits, or admin controls, you're on paid plans that add up quickly for a small team.

Ambisius uses a credit-based model — you pay for what you actually build and change, not for how many people use the app. Chatting with the AI and exploring is free. Credits are only consumed when you confirm a change and the AI applies it. New users also receive free starter credits to try the product before committing.

Choose Airtable if:

  • Your team has technical experience
    If someone on your team is comfortable with databases or spreadsheet tools, Airtable's flexibility is a genuine advantage.
  • You need deep third-party integrations
    Airtable connects to Slack, Zapier, Salesforce, and hundreds of other tools — ideal for teams already embedded in a larger software stack.
  • You have dedicated ops staff to maintain the system
    Airtable rewards investment. If you have someone who can build and maintain it, it's a powerful platform.
